Post by: ant on January 16, 2009, 04:47:04 am
Bern,

I'm pretty sure the problems with kernel not found in nand are originated by corrupted jffs filesystem.
How do you install and edit the images?

On c860 I can even install two images on nand:

flash_eraseall /dev/mtd2
flash_eraseall /dev/mtd3

nandwrite /dev/mtd2  myfirstimage.jffs2.bin
nandwrite /dev/mtd3  mysecondimage.jffs2.bin

But you can't yet use the standard images provided by openembedded...some changes are needed:
- populate /boot
- edit fstab
- remove 16bytes Sharp headers if you want to flash by hand (updater.sh does it automatically)

Please remember kexecboot/multiboot is not yet finished.
The kexecboot-kernels for c7x0 and akita were lacking the CF boot while spitz missed nand boot.
Why? Because the kernel size on Zaurus is limited...some options were compiled as module..and the work started from standard angstrom kernels.

What does it mean?
If we compile all the options the standard kernel will be too big to be flashed on nand...i.e. we'll break compatibility with Sharp layout (kernel in mtd1).
